![]() Accompanied by the talented and charming ‘Athenian Sisters’, inspired by the well-known and loved ‘Andrew Sisters’, they’ve arrived to entertain the troops. Their weapon - abstaining from sex.This version of the play was reconceptualised to be set in 1940’s wartime, performed in a cabaret style drawing from the atmosphere of a USO show. This adaptation retells the story of a group of women fighting for the control of Athens to put a stop to the Peloponnesian War. In May 2014 Third year Theatre/Media students presented their modern adaptation of Aristophanes’ ancient Greek comedy, Lysistrata. Performed, designed and managed by Final Year Theatre/Media students, 2014 ![]() ![]() ![]() Produced by CYCLE Productions and the School of Communication & Creative Industries, Charles Sturt University ![]()
